Book a Demo!
CoCalc Logo Icon
StoreFeaturesDocsShareSupportNewsAboutPoliciesSign UpSign In
CloudPak-Outcomes
GitHub Repository: CloudPak-Outcomes/Outcomes-Projects
Path: blob/main/L4assets/AIGovernanceAssets/ConfigFiles/_trigger_config_.xml
1928 views
1
<?xml version="1.0" encoding="UTF-8" ?>
2
<trigger-definitions>
3
<grcTrigger name="Add RabbitMQ Event On Model Create" event="create.object" position="POST">
4
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
5
<attribute name="content.type" value="Model"/>
6
</rule>
7
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
8
</eventHandler>
9
</grcTrigger>
10
<grcTrigger name="Add RabbitMQ Event On Model Update" event="update.object" position="POST">
11
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
12
<attribute name="content.type" value="Model"/>
13
</rule>
14
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
15
</eventHandler>
16
</grcTrigger>
17
<grcTrigger name="Add RabbitMQ Event On Model Delete" event="delete.objects" position="PRE">
18
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
19
<attribute name="content.type" value="Model"/>
20
</rule>
21
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
22
</eventHandler>
23
</grcTrigger>
24
<grcTrigger name="Add RabbitMQ Event On Model Associate" event="associate.objects" position="PRE">
25
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
26
<attribute name="content.type" value="Model"/>
27
</rule>
28
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
29
</eventHandler>
30
</grcTrigger>
31
<grcTrigger name="Add RabbitMQ Event On Model Disassociate" event="disassociate.objects" position="PRE">
32
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
33
<attribute name="content.type" value="Model"/>
34
</rule>
35
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
36
</eventHandler>
37
</grcTrigger>
38
<grcTrigger name="Add RabbitMQ Event On Register Create" event="create.object" position="POST">
39
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
40
<attribute name="content.type" value="Register"/>
41
</rule>
42
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
43
</eventHandler>
44
</grcTrigger>
45
<grcTrigger name="Add RabbitMQ Event On Register Update" event="update.object" position="POST">
46
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
47
<attribute name="content.type" value="Register"/>
48
</rule>
49
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
50
</eventHandler>
51
</grcTrigger>
52
<grcTrigger name="Add RabbitMQ Event On Register Delete" event="delete.objects" position="PRE">
53
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
54
<attribute name="content.type" value="Register"/>
55
</rule>
56
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
57
</eventHandler>
58
</grcTrigger>
59
<grcTrigger name="Add RabbitMQ Event On Register Associate" event="associate.objects" position="PRE">
60
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
61
<attribute name="content.type" value="Register"/>
62
</rule>
63
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
64
</eventHandler>
65
</grcTrigger>
66
<grcTrigger name="Add RabbitMQ Event On Register Disassociate" event="disassociate.objects" position="PRE">
67
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
68
<attribute name="content.type" value="Register"/>
69
</rule>
70
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
71
</eventHandler>
72
</grcTrigger>
73
<grcTrigger name="Add RabbitMQ Event On Usage Delete" event="delete.objects" position="PRE">
74
<rule class="com.ibm.openpages.api.trigger.oob.ContentTypeMatchRule">
75
<attribute name="content.type" value="Usage"/>
76
</rule>
77
<eventHandler class="com.ibm.openpages.api.trigger.oob.messaging.RabbitMQObjectChangeEventHandler">
78
</eventHandler>
79
</grcTrigger>
80
</trigger-definitions>
81
82